> Anybody successfully participating in an install of a PM4 where different
> companies are using different ports (dialup) yet sharing the same chassis?
>
> Lucent is markteting the PM4 to CLECs as a way to save money by
> consolidating accounts in the same chassis (at least that's what I gather
> from the marketing). Has anybody successfully achieved what Lucent
> marketing is telling? From a customer (ISP renting ports from CLEC) or as
> an owner (renting ports to an ISP) perspective.
>
> Looking for any success/failure stories, gotchas, etc...

Yes, many CLECs and regional telcos are doing it. Last week I just
finished working with setting RADIUS ABM up to manage multiple POPs
using PM4s. Using RADIUS ABM you can limit the connects by
Called-Station-Id, Realm, Company, POP, and combinations of them. For
example you can setup company X to be allowed a total 50 ports in 10 of
your POPs but only 12 logins per pop max.
